An IFSC (Indian Financial System Code) is an 11-character alphanumeric code issued by the Reserve Bank of India. It uniquely identifies every bank branch that participates in the RBI's electronic fund-transfer systems – NEFT, RTGS and IMPS. The first four characters represent the bank, the fifth is always a zero (reserved for future use), and the last six characters identify the specific branch.
For The Shamrao Vithal Cooperative Bank's OMPRAKASH DEORA PEOPLES COOP BK HINGOLI-AUNDH branch, the IFSC SVCB0009030 breaks down as follows: SVCB identifies the bank, 0 is the reserved character, and 009030 identifies this particular branch.

Why every The Shamrao Vithal Cooperative Bank branch has a unique IFSC
Before electronic settlement systems went live in India, money transfers between banks relied heavily on demand drafts, mail transfers and telegraphic transfers. These older instruments routinely took days to clear and were prone to misrouting because there was no single machine-readable identifier for a branch. The Reserve Bank of India solved this by issuing each participating branch — including OMPRAKASH DEORA PEOPLES COOP BK HINGOLI-AUNDH of The Shamrao Vithal Cooperative Bank — its own 11-character IFSC. The code SVCB0009030 is therefore not just an internal reference; it is the digital postcode that lets the RBI's NEFT, RTGS and IMPS rails route funds straight to the right branch ledger without any human intervention.
Today, almost every salary credit, vendor payment, refund and EMI deduction in the country flows through this network, which is exactly why a correct IFSC matters so much. A wrong character can either bounce the transfer or send it to the wrong branch, and reversing such a credit is a manual, time-consuming process. Treat IFSC SVCB0009030 the same way you would treat your account number — verify it once and save it carefully for future use.

Comparing NEFT, RTGS and IMPS for transfers to Omprakash Deora Peoples Coop Bk Hingoli-Aundh
The right transfer rail depends on how urgent the payment is, how large it is, and whether the receiving bank participates in the chosen scheme. Every option below works with the IFSC SVCB0009030:
- NEFT — best for everyday transfers of any amount; settles in half-hourly batches around the clock.
- RTGS — best for transfers of ₹2 lakh and above; settles each transaction individually in real time.
- IMPS — best when speed matters more than batch scheduling; instant credit up to ₹5 lakh.
- UPI — best for small peer-to-peer payments using a VPA; the underlying account at OMPRAKASH DEORA PEOPLES COOP BK HINGOLI-AUNDH is still linked to IFSC SVCB0009030.
For salary credits, vendor payouts and refunds, employers and merchants usually default to NEFT because of its zero per-transaction cost for retail customers and its 24x7 availability.
How UPI relates to the IFSC code
UPI lets you pay using a short Virtual Payment Address instead of typing the IFSC every time, but behind the scenes every UPI mandate is mapped to an account number plus an IFSC. For accounts at The Shamrao Vithal Cooperative Bank's OMPRAKASH DEORA PEOPLES COOP BK HINGOLI-AUNDH branch, the IFSC SVCB0009030 is what the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) uses to route the credit when you tap Pay on a UPI app.
That is why, even in the UPI era, it is still worth knowing the IFSC of your home branch — for failed UPI mandates, e-mandate set-ups, third-party platform onboarding and salary or refund credits.
